Book Description
About the Book:

This is the extensively revised edition of the classic book that presented the author's discovery of an astronomical code in the organization of the Rgveda. This code has changed our understanding of the Vedic system of knowledge, rise of earliest astronomy, history of science, and the chronology of ancient India. The work was first reported in a series of journal articles; this book brings together these discoveries between the same two covers for the first time. Some comments on this work:

About the Author:

Subhash Kak is a widely known scientist and Indologist. Currently a professor of electrical and computer engineering at the Louisiana State University at Baton Rogue. He has authored ten books and more than 200 papers in various fields. Apart from his work on Indian astronomy, he has researched linguistics, Vedic science and history.
